First MIL

I was hoping to be trouble and problem free but my 2012 MCS with less than 8K miles just threw a code. I read it with my scanner tool I had and it read out P0301 - cylinder 1 misfire. It's now at the dealer and I am driving a loaner. I'm bummed that I don't have my car with me already :(

Also, not sure if this is related somehow but I noticed that the idle would drop suddenly when the engine would not be fully warmed up. You can feel it in the car when then idle drops and bounces back up. The idle drop does not occur after the car is warm. Any ideas?

Picked up my baby today!

Paperwork states all 4 spark plugs replaced, all 4 injectors replaced, profile gasket. Compression test and leaked down test and checked high pressure pump and checked out ok.

I hope this will be it for awhile! Happy to be motoring again !!!!!

So, I've since put another 4000 miles and no CEL! However, I still have what I consider an abnormal idle dip issue. When I first start car on a cold start the RPMs start off high and then slowly come down to "normal" idle range and I start off driving. Within the first 10 mins of driving, for example, coming to a stop sign or stop light the idle will "dip or drop" as if it were about to stall...but it hasn't stalled. It will do this on random days but not every day. I have not noticed it after that first 10 mins of driving so I believe it's related to initial start up. Idle remains stable after completely driven beyond 10 mins. Car has 12k miles now. Only pump premium. Any ideas what to check? Thanks
